Job description

Class Description

CCBC is the college of choice for over 50,000 students and 200 businesses each year — all with unique goals, strengths and requirements. By offering a holistic learning environment that is both accepting and challenging, we meet students where they are and take them where they want to go. We offer the region’s most expansive selection of degree, certificate and workplace certification programs at 3 campuses plus 3 convenient CCBC centers along with off‑site community locations.

Responsibilities

Teach college‑level non‑credit Continuing Education courses focusing on:

  • Central services technician
  • Community health worker
  • CPR
  • Dental assistant
  • Health IT
  • Medical assistant
  • Medical billing
  • Medical coding
  • Medical office support
  • Nursing assistant
  • Nurse refresher
  • Patient care technician
  • Pharmacy technician
  • Physical therapy tech/aide
  • Sleep technologist
  • Surgical technology
  • Unit clerk
  • Phlebotomy
  • Veterinary assistant
Minimum Requirements
  • Must possess the appropriate professional credential or educational level in the field of teaching. Bachelors or Master’s preferred.
  • Must be a subject matter expert.
  • Computer proficiency required.
  • Experience teaching or training in an adult setting preferred.
Campus Locations

Essex, Dundalk, Catonsville, Hunt Valley, Randallstown & Owings Mills.

Pay Rates

Pay rates for the non‑credit courses in Continuing Education are commensurate with education and experience qualifications.

Benefits
  • Supplemental retirement: 403(b) and 457(b) plans. 403(b) is a tax‑shielded annuity; 457(b) is a deferred compensation plan.
  • Parking: Free, but a permit from the Department of Public Safety is required on all campuses.
  • Sick and Safe Leave: Paid leave available to all part‑time employees, including adjunct faculty, part‑time associates and other part‑time employees.
